正文
python多个字符替换一个字符,python replace函数替换多个字符
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
replace函数三个参数
参数1:Old_text是要替换其部分字符的文本。参数2:Start_num是要用new_text替换的old_text中字符的位置。参数3:Num_chars是希望REPLACE使用new_text替换old_text中字符的个数。
其中,replace函数的三个参数分别为字符串(str)、待查找的字符(char1)和替换的字符(char2)。函数中使用循环遍历字符串,查找第一个字符,并进行替换,直到找到或者遍历完整个字符串为止。
Replace函数是把字符串中的old(旧字符串)替换成new(新字符串),如果指定第三个参数max,则替换不超过max次。replace函数包含于头文件includestring中。
python替换最后一个字符
先将字符串转换成列表,之后再修改列表中的元素来完成,通过list(r)来将r字符串转化成了一个列表。然后修改单个列表的元素,将第二个元素d替换成了m。最后通过join的方法把列表中的元素合成一个字符串。
说明 python去除字符串最后一个字符可以使用简单的切片法。
print(s[:-1])s[:-1]的意思就是s字符串取从第0个字符至倒数第一个字符的前一个字符,这样就达到了去掉最后一个字符的目的。学习,是指通过阅读、听讲、思考、研究、实践等途径获得知识和技能的过程。
使用python-docx 有兴趣的可以深入学习一下python-docx,这里仅仅是实现需求。python-docx只能处理docx所以doc需要转为docx具体方法可以自行百度。
如何用Python来进行查询和替换一个文本字符串
在python中,str对象有一个方法用于实现这种功能,这个方法是:str.format(*args,**kwargs)。例子:1+2={0}.format(1+2) #{0}是占位符,其中0表示是第一个需要被替换的。
有一个额外的 na 参数,用于将缺失值替换为 True 或 False 您可以从字符串列中提取指标变量。
用str.split(,)只能分隔逗号一种;如果涉及到多重分隔的话就需要使用re.split(,|:)。 原字符串以逗号分隔的,后面有一个或多个字符串,所以re.split(, | )。
在单(双)引号前加入一个反斜杠,Python解释器就不会把这个它认为是字符串结束的标志,而认为它就是普通的字符。在一个字符串中,如果同时存在单引号和双引号,那么使用反斜杠来转移单、双引号就是必须的了。
作为替换的组号 在2的例子中,只是把一个字符串用其他的内容替换掉了。用replace这个字符串方法能轻松达到同样的效果。而正则表达式允许以更灵活的方式进行搜索,同时它们也允许进行功能更强大的替换。
python怎么替换最后一个字符?
1、先将字符串转换成列表,之后再修改列表中的元素来完成,通过list(r)来将r字符串转化成了一个列表。然后修改单个列表的元素,将第二个元素d替换成了m。最后通过join的方法把列表中的元素合成一个字符串。
2、说明 python去除字符串最后一个字符可以使用简单的切片法。
3、print(s[:-1])s[:-1]的意思就是s字符串取从第0个字符至倒数第一个字符的前一个字符,这样就达到了去掉最后一个字符的目的。学习,是指通过阅读、听讲、思考、研究、实践等途径获得知识和技能的过程。
python读取文本文件,如何将每行最后一个特定字符替换?
1、Python中操作换行符的函数为:replace(\n,),替换函数;步骤:先判断读取文件,判断每一行是不是只包含换行符:如果是,则直接删除;如果不是,则用replace(\n,)替换所有换行符,并在最后加一个换行符。
2、先将字符串转换成列表,之后再修改列表中的元素来完成,通过list(r)来将r字符串转化成了一个列表。然后修改单个列表的元素,将第二个元素d替换成了m。最后通过join的方法把列表中的元素合成一个字符串。
3、打开需要修改的文件代码。因为有中文的缘故,strip(),rstrip(),strip(\n)等等都会丢失数据。改用replace函数。先看看这里的换行符到底是哪个,是‘\n’。替换。
4、-1]+norn[1:-1]+norn[0]#交换首尾字符 print newline 少女处女杀手的有多处错误: file是内置函索和open功能一样。应该给r加上引号 字符是不可变,不可以原地修改,list[0]=xxx这样是不行的。
5、in cnts: cnt = cnt.strip() if cnt.endswith(,): cnt = cnt[:-1] fo.write(cnt + \n)fo.close()Python 代码。 保存成 py文件,放到 11txt 同一目录下执行即可。
python编写一个自动替换word文档文字程序
遍历word中的所有 paragraphs,在每一段中发现含有key 的内容,就替换为 value 。 (key 和 value 都是replace_dict中的键值对。
最后,你可以点击替换按钮完成操作。当然,如果你的文档非常大,你可能需要一些更高级的工具来完成批量替换。一些文本编辑器和脚本语言可以帮助你快速而自动地完成这项任务。
打开文本编辑器,将包含全文的文本文件导入编辑器中。 使用编辑器的查找和替换功能进行替换。不同的编辑器可能具有不同的替换方式,但通常提供查找和替换的选项。
打开一份 document.xml 文件,抛开header、footer、table以及其他特殊项,去掉样式等修饰项,一份朴素的docx文档主要可以分为三个部分:paragraph、run、text paragraph即段落,就是我们在word当中看到的一段。
要在Python中修改Word表格内容并保持原格式不变,可以使用python-docx库。
最后一个参数,全部替换是2,但是selection每次只能是1个地方。
关于python多个字符替换一个字符和python replace函数替换多个字符的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。